			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>   Kerouac&#8217;s <i>On the Road</i> was the first book I read after I moved to Reno a little over two years ago. The story tied in perfectly with the road adventure I had just embarked on; driving from St. Louis through flat Kansas, over the cold, tall Rockies, across the &#8220;Loneliest Road in America,&#8221; and down into what I would later see as the pit-hole that is Reno. I also felt a sense of connectivity with Kerouac&#8217;s character: the philosophic observer who throws caution to the wind in exchange for a life of experience and sensation. Where I got lost on my journey, I now realize, is that, after a while, it stopped being a journey. I still had bills to pay so I got a job. Instead of using what I worked for for higher purposes, I drank it all at crappy college bars where I rarely ever even had an intelligent conversation.<br />
<a href="http://lusiddisillusions.wordpress.com/2009/02/04/essay-challenge-2009-beat-philosophy/kerouac_71139a_72365t/" rel="attachment wp-att-95"><img src="http://lusiddisillusions.files.wordpress.com/2009/02/kerouac_71139a_72365t.jpg?w=300&#038;h=240" alt="kerouac_71139a_72365t" title="kerouac_71139a_72365t" width="300" height="240" class="alignright size-full wp-image-95" /></a>   This all comes to mind after reading my first essay for the 2009 challenge, <a href="http://stirrings-still.org/vol1no1.pdf"><i>Existentialism and the Beats: A<br />
Renegotiation</i></a>, by Erik Ronald Mortenson. Like the title suggests, Mortenson&#8217;s main idea in this essay is that, while the Beats had an obvious respect for the existentialists who predated them, they themselves were their own entity whose members chose a path of experience rather than philosophical meandering. Mortenson highlights the different writing styles of the two movements as an example:</p>
<blockquote><p>The schism here is between reflective and spontaneous forms of writing. Existentialists may try to “entice” their readers into authenticity with fictional accounts, but their use of the literary is almost always based on a concretization of abstract, reflective thought&#8230;The Beats do not entice; they demonstrate. An ancillary goal is to get the reader to develop their own brand of authenticity, but their primary goal is to present the authenticity that they have achieved (or are trying to achieve) to the reader via the written word.</p></blockquote>
<p>   Mortenson says that this experience is demonstrated to the reader by the Beat&#8217;s pervasive use of prose. This is evident in Ginsburg, from <i>Howl</i>, to his letter to the Hell&#8217;s Angels (no link, see Hunter S. Thompson&#8217;s <i>Hell&#8217;s Angels</i>). Kerouac even suggests writing “without consciousness in semi-trance.&#8221; The influence of Freud upon the Beat&#8217;s does not go unnoticed in this essay.<br />
   After reading this essay, I am tempted to go back and reread <i>On the Road</i> as well as other Kerouac classics, like <i>Dr. Sax</i> and, of course, <i>Dharma Bums</i> and <i>The Subterraneans</i>. I also have a renewed optimism about the journey that life is and must not forget to keep on with the experience of every moment.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://lusiddisillusions.wordpress.com/2009/02/03/vegan-adventures-in-cooking/vegan-vengeance2/" rel="attachment wp-att-84"><img src="http://lusiddisillusions.files.wordpress.com/2009/02/vegan-vengeance2.jpg?w=190&#038;h=248" alt="vegan-vengeance2" title="vegan-vengeance2" width="190" height="248"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-84" /></a>I recently purchased Isa Chandra Moskowitz&#8217;s <i>Vegan With a Vengeance</i> recipe book. I am not vegan, nor am I even vegetarian, but I do see the positive benefits of eliminating meat and dairy from one&#8217;s diet and I admire the act of protest that veganism offers against the systematic abuse of animals in those industries. Isa&#8217;s book mostly highlights this second attribute of veganism, combining it with plenty of punky-playfulness, anarchich-DIY tips, and notes from her cat, all the while leaving out the boring health-related stuff we already know and which can all too often become repetitive in diet-specific cookbooks.</p>
<p>Since getting this book, I have excitedly cooked two recipes from it and another two from Isa&#8217;s related website, <i>The Post-Punk Kitchen</i> (see link in sidebar). I must confess, I had no idea that vegan food could be so delicious! While devouring the recipes I&#8217;ve made (and saving some leftovers for later) I experienced a new found satisfaction in knowing that what was tasting so good on my tongue did not involve strapping animals to sucking machines, cooping them up in unnatural environments, and/or slamming bolts through their skulls. Even without this satisfaction, the food was among the best I&#8217;ve ever eaten.</p>
<p><a href="http://lusiddisillusions.wordpress.com/2009/02/03/vegan-adventures-in-cooking/vegan-recipes-0412/" rel="attachment wp-att-74"><img src="http://lusiddisillusions.files.wordpress.com/2009/02/vegan-recipes-0412.jpg?w=300&#038;h=225" alt="vegan-recipes-0412" title="vegan-recipes-0412" width="300" height="225"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-74" /></a>Last Friday, I made &#8220;Eggplant and Squash alla Napoletana&#8221; from <i>Vegan With a Vengeance</i>, page 188. Making this recipe also required that I make the &#8220;Sun-dried Tomato Pesto&#8221; from pages 183. I found the pesto very easy to make, but, next time I must be sure not to use pre-olive-oil-soaked tomatoes, for they gave the pesto a potent, pizza-y flavor which I found slightly over-powering. Other than that, I learned how easy pesto is to make.</p>
<p><a href="http://lusiddisillusions.wordpress.com/2009/02/03/vegan-adventures-in-cooking/vegan-recipes-069/" rel="attachment wp-att-68"><img src="http://lusiddisillusions.files.wordpress.com/2009/02/vegan-recipes-069.jpg?w=300&#038;h=225" alt="vegan-recipes-069" title="vegan-recipes-069" width="300" height="225"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-68" /></a>Putting together the other ingredients was a bit more complicated, but still not very difficult. While I liked the way the squash-mash turned out, I found that I don&#8217;t much care for fried eggplant. That aside, the entire meal was delicious. I hungrily wolfed it down, as did my uncle. Leftovers were even better after the flavors had had a chance to meld together overnight. Three days later, I am still eating it!</p>

Though I am a great admirer of his philosophical and historical insights, it is extremely rare for the name &#8220;Terrence McKenna&#8221;  to ever come up in my conversations with others. The main reason for this is because, outside of the internet, I have very few friends or associations who share my passion for the type of theories and ruminations that McKenna was so great at and well known for espousing. In fact, it has only happened once that someone has seen one of McKenna&#8217;s books upon my shelf and become excited because they, too, knew who he was. While this, in return, also excited me greatly, the conversation which ensued between us was not very memorable. The reason for this was because we each had such different construct in our heads about who we believed the man to be. While Terrence&#8217;s work, to me, has always been so much more than adolescent drug culture and idol-worship, I did not know him for much more than his lectures, books, and theories which were, admittedly, influenced by McKenna&#8217;s use of a plethora of entheogenic substances, a.k.a&#8230; drugs. I never bothered finding out what type of man he was at home or when he wasn&#8217;t doing the things he was so well known for doing (again.., drugs). Today, I discovered that he collected butterflies. Each butterfly he captured he wrapped inside of a tiny piece of paper; paper from magazines and newspapers for example, even old bank receipts&#8230;, and each piece of paper, like the dates and locations he marked on them, in turn, also told their own tales. These tiny, folded, paper-coffins became the final resting places for the insects inside them until even after McKenna&#8217;s own death when, in 2007, his daughter, Klea, began unwrapping and photographing them. Her wonderful exhibit, <a href="http://www.kleamckenna.com/#a=0&amp;at=0&amp;mi=2&amp;pt=1&amp;pi=10000&amp;s=0&amp;p=0">The Butterfly Hunter</a>, displays each of these artifacts, each with its own tale, in chronological order upon a bare white canvas. The exhibit will take you out of the mindset of fractals and psychedelics and show you another side of Terrence McKenna; a side which perhaps believed that if walking caterpillars could sprout wings and fly, maybe, one day, we would too.</p>
